Why Camping Solar Panels Support Solo Hiking

Lightweight Gear Keeps Hiking Efficient and Manageable

Solo hikers choose gear based on weight, reliability, and the ability to serve multiple purposes. A compact solar panel can replace several heavy power banks by offering continuous energy throughout the trip. The PS100 weighs just 4.4 kg (9.7 lb) when folded and fits easily into a pack or can be strapped to the outside during movement. By unfolding the panel during breaks or at camp, hikers charge a variety of devices—including GPS units, lights, compact power stations, or phones—without relying on traditional outlets. This reduces overall pack weight while offering renewable energy access during extended trips. When weight is critical, portability becomes the deciding factor, and a panel built for folding and transport makes energy planning more efficient.

Renewable Energy Ensures Continuous Power Away from Civilization

Solo hikers cannot depend on finding places to recharge. Trails, campsites, and remote landscapes rarely provide stable electricity, making solar the most reliable long-term power solution. The panel solar camping PS100 captures sunlight using high-efficiency monocrystalline cells, generating up to 100W whenever sunlight is available. Because it offers up to 23% conversion efficiency, hikers gain more usable energy even on partly cloudy days or in varied terrain. Adjusting the angle to 30°, 40°, 50°, or 80° allows hikers to position the panel for maximum absorption regardless of time of day. Reliable, renewable energy increases safety because devices used for navigation and communication stay charged throughout the journey.

Rugged Construction Protects Against Demanding Outdoor Conditions

Solo hikers face unpredictable weather and rough handling as part of every adventure. A camping panel must withstand these challenges without adding risk. The PS100’s ETFE coating creates a tough, scratch-resistant surface, and its IP67 waterproof design protects the panel from rain, puddles, and dust. A hiker can set it on damp ground, lean it against rocks, or use it during sudden showers without worrying about damage. The MC4 connection offers a stable link to power stations or devices, reducing the chance of energy loss due to movement or vibration. For hikers who must rely on each piece of equipment, durability ensures the panel functions consistently throughout the trip.

How Solo Hikers Use Solar Panels Effectively on the Trail

Midday Charging Sessions Maximize Energy Gain

Solo hikers often take breaks to rest, hydrate, or check maps. These pauses are ideal for solar charging. By unfolding the PS100 at the correct angle, the panel absorbs strong midday sunlight and replenishes portable power stations or devices quickly. Because the panel uses a stable MC4 connection, it maintains efficient output without requiring constant supervision. Solo hikers can continue preparing food, exploring nearby viewpoints, or setting up camp while the panel works silently in the background. These midday sessions reduce the weight of stored batteries needed for overnight use and keep power accessible throughout the entire journey.

Charging While Setting Up Camp Supports Evening Comfort and Safety

At camp, hikers settle in, cook, journal, and check their route for the next day. This routine requires power for lighting, GPS units, cameras, and communication devices. Evening power shortages can cause unnecessary stress or inconvenience. Solar panels bridge this gap by collecting sunlight during late afternoon hours. With the PS100’s adjustable angles, hikers capture the remaining low-angle sunlight effectively. Once camp is established, the panel continues working until dusk. This preparation ensures devices are ready for night activities such as stargazing, reading, or staying visible to nearby campers. Consistent evening power boosts comfort and confidence.

Reliable Power Supports Emergency Preparedness on Solo Trips

Safety is the top priority for solo hikers, and a dependable energy source improves the ability to respond to emergencies. Charged phones, satellite messengers, and headlamps become lifelines in difficult terrain. A lightweight panel solar camping solution acts as a safeguard, offering renewable power even if a hiker gets delayed or encounters bad weather. The PS100’s robust build allows it to function through unpredictable conditions, keeping communication tools powered. Even in isolated regions, hikers maintain control over their safety equipment. This makes solar a practical addition for anyone traveling alone where help may not be immediately available.
